Miner Creek is a challenging 20-mile backcountry trek that traverses through Montana's rugged terrain, gaining over 2,200 feet of elevation. This remote trail follows creek drainages and alpine meadows, offering solitude and expansive mountain vistas for experienced hikers willing to tackle a full day or overnight adventure. The route showcases classic Northern Rockies scenery with potential wildlife viewing opportunities in this less-traveled corridor.
